Comparing Official Lyrics and Web Sources
The song begins with a gentle scene, inviting someone to sit beneath a willow tree. This peaceful imagery quickly gives way to the powerful, recurring chorus. The phrases “I can’t lie, I can’t hide” and “I can’t deny, let me confide” create a hypnotic rhythm.
This repetition mirrors the obsessive nature of longing. It’s a clever lyrical device that pulls the listener into the narrator’s emotional state. The authenticity of these words is confirmed by their uniform presentation online.
Exploring Lyric Translations and Variations
A significant turn in the narrative occurs mid-song. The hopeful tone shifts with the painful line, “But you, you look through me blind… and you, you’ll never be mine.” This moment reveals the core conflict of unrequited affection.
The compressed, almost rushed phrasing in parts like “wastin’ my time thinkin’ of you” adds a layer of raw urgency. For international audiences, translations available on these platforms ensure the emotional core of the track is accessible to all, highlighting its universal themes.

Interpreting Key Imagery and Metaphors
The willow tree serves as a powerful opening symbol. It represents both romantic refuge and the bittersweet nature of longing. The invitation to lay beside the narrator creates intimate imagery that contrasts with reality.
This intimate moment suggests what could be if the relationship were different. The phrase like lovers emphasizes the gap between desire and actual connection. It’s a poignant contrast that runs throughout the composition.
Emotional Undertones and Song Narrative
The metaphor of someone who look blindi at the narrator is particularly striking. The subject looks but doesn’t truly see the romantic interest. When the narrator says I close my eyes, it suggests both escape and pain.
The devastating realization that you’ll never be mine transforms the entire meaning. What seemed like willing time spent becomes never minewastin precious emotional resources. This time thinkin about someone represents a universal experience.
